BOARD OF GOVERNORS OF THE FEDERAL RESERVE SYSTEM
(For Immediate Release)

April 24, 1952

CONDITION OF THE FEDERAL RESERVE BANKS
Member Bank Reserves and Related Items
During the week ended April 23, Member bank reserves decreased
$3^3 million. The principal changes reducing reserves were an increase of
$357 million in Treasury deposits with Federal Reserve Banks and a decrease of
$136 million in Reserve Bank credit. The principal offsetting changes were
decreases of $103 million in Money in circulation and $38 million in Foreign
deposits with Federal Reserve Banks.
The decrease of $136 million in Reserve Bank credit resulted from
decreases of $249 million in Float and $95 million in U. S, Government securities,
and an increase of $208 million in Loans, discounts and advances. Holdings of
U. S. Government securities reflected a decrease of $95 million in certificates.
